动态MP4动效技术深度解析:从静态资源到智能交互的革命
【免费下载链接】YYEVAYYEVA(YY Effect Video Animate)是YYLive推出的一个开源的支持可插入动态元素的MP4动效播放器解决方案,包含设计资源输出的AE插件,客户端渲染引擎,在线预览工具。项目地址: https://gitcode.com/gh_mirrors/yy/YYEVA
在数字内容日益丰富的今天,传统静态MP4资源的局限性愈发明显。当用户期望看到实时更新的昵称、动态变化的数字或个性化头像时,传统的视频编码技术往往显得力不从心。动态MP4动效技术的出现,正是为了解决这一核心痛点。
技术架构的核心突破
动态MP4动效技术并非简单的视频编码升级,而是一套完整的动态内容生态系统。其核心架构包含三个关键层面:
渲染引擎层
采用分层渲染机制,将静态背景与动态元素分离处理。这种设计使得在播放过程中可以实时更新特定区域的内容,而无需重新编码整个视频文件。
数据驱动层
通过轻量级的数据结构,实现动态内容的实时注入。相比传统的序列帧动画,这种方案在文件大小和渲染效率上都有显著优势。
跨平台适配层
统一的资源格式配合平台特定的渲染优化,确保在不同设备和系统上都能获得一致的视觉效果。
动态MP4动效渲染全流程 - 从资源制作到多平台输出
实际应用场景深度剖析
直播互动场景
在直播平台中,用户昵称、礼物数量、弹幕内容等都需要实时更新。动态MP4动效技术能够在不中断播放的情况下,动态替换这些内容元素。
电商营销场景
商品价格、倒计时、库存数量等信息的实时展示,大大提升了营销效果和用户转化率。
直播PK场景中的动态MP4应用 - 实时数据更新与交互反馈
技术实现的关键挑战与解决方案
实时性与流畅度平衡
如何在保证实时更新的同时维持播放流畅度?动态MP4技术通过预加载机制和智能缓存策略,在内存占用和渲染性能之间找到最佳平衡点。
跨平台一致性保证
不同设备、不同系统的渲染差异如何解决?通过统一的色彩空间管理和标准化尺寸参数,确保视觉效果的一致性。
性能优化实战指南
资源制作规范
- 动态元素区域预留充足空间
- 关键帧间隔合理设置
- 色彩空间标准化配置
渲染效率提升
- 硬件加速优化
- 分层渲染机制
- 智能降级策略
动态MP4转换工具界面 - 参数配置与编码输出
未来发展趋势展望
动态MP4动效技术正在向更智能、更交互的方向发展。随着AI技术的融合,未来的动态内容将能够根据用户行为和场景自动调整。
开发者实践建议
对于希望集成动态MP4技术的开发者,建议从以下几个方向入手:
- 理解业务场景:明确动态内容的具体需求
- 选择合适工具:根据平台特点选用对应的渲染引擎
- 注重性能测试:在不同设备上进行充分的性能验证
动态MP4动效技术正在重新定义数字内容的边界,为开发者提供了前所未有的创作自由度。无论是简单的文本替换还是复杂的特效叠加,这项技术都能提供稳定高效的解决方案。
【免费下载链接】YYEVAYYEVA(YY Effect Video Animate)是YYLive推出的一个开源的支持可插入动态元素的MP4动效播放器解决方案,包含设计资源输出的AE插件,客户端渲染引擎,在线预览工具。项目地址: https://gitcode.com/gh_mirrors/yy/YYEVA
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考